题解 1115: DNA

来看看其他人写的题解吧!要先自己动手做才会有提高哦! 
返回题目 | 我来写题解

筛选

DNA-题解(Java代码)

摘要:解题思路:注意事项:参考代码:Scanner scanner=new Scanner(System.in); int n=scanner.nextInt(); int a,b; for (int i ……

DNA-题解(Java代码)

摘要:### 思路: 一个单位DNA为a行,重复度为b,那么他的总行数就是a\*b-b+1 观察每一行“X”的分布,设行号为i,(0~a\*b-b),则每行两个“X”出现的位置就是:**i%(a-1)*……

DNA-题解(Java代码)

摘要:解题思路:将输出的形状看成一个字符串的二维数组,先将数组里面都插入" ",然后再进行循环插入X。只要注意插入X的位置的规律,这道题就很容易写。数组的列永远都是1——a,只有行的数量是在增加的。大家看我……
优质题解

DNA-题解(Java代码)详解可输出多组

摘要:解题思路:   每一组的总行数为   a*b-(b-1)                      前端的空白个数数顺序 从 0 递增到(a-1/2)个空白 再递减到 0               ……

DNA-题解(Java代码)

摘要:解题思路:看每个子链,是个对称的图形,可以用一个 for 循环将其打印出:注意事项:for (int j = 0; j < st[s]; j++) {//每行的打印if (j==i||j==st[s]……

DNA-题解(C++代码)找规律

摘要:自己的一些想法,找规律罢了。。。。 ```cpp #include using namespace std; int box[2][16]; void printBlank(int n)……
优质题解

DNA-题解(C语言代码)(较简单循环方式)

摘要:思路:通过字符数组解决,对数组内元素循环处理。最外层循环处理N组数据,第二层循环b次,每次输出a-1行内容,里层循环输出字符数组one[a],最后单独输出末行 注意事项: 1.第二层循环每循环……

DNA-题解(C++代码)

摘要:解题思路:规律如代码所示注意事项:多重复度时从第二个开始不打印第一行,注意每个样例之间要多一空行参考代码:#include<bits/stdc++.h> using namespace std; ……